James J. Ryan Jr., 76, passed away Thursday, Nov. 15, 2012, with his family at his side. 

He was a U.S. Navy veteran and relocated to Englewood, Fla., from Brookfield, Conn., in 1991. James retired from SNET (Southern New England Telephone) in 1988. Sports was his love and he participated in all of his children’s activities as well as his own. James was an usher at St. Raphael’s Church, and an active member in the Knights of Columbus, especially with organizing the golf tournaments, and obtaining donated articles for the V.A. Vets.

He is survived by his wife of 52 years, Anna Marie; sons, James J. III of Colorado, Timothy of North Carolina, Keith and Heather Ryan of Connecticut; daughter, Donna and John Krafick of Connecticut; eight grandchildren; brothers, David and Ruth Ann, Kevin, and Eileen, Terry, and Jeanne; and sister, Ann and Lee Mellinger. James is preceded in death by his sister, Helen Higgins.

Funeral Mass will be held at 10 a.m. Monday, Nov. 26, 2012, at St. Raphael’s Church. In lieu of flowers the family requests donations be made to Tidewell Hospice, 5955 Rand Blvd., Sarasota FL 34238.

Arrangements are by Lemon Bay Funeral Home and Cremation Services.
